About Moore Industries:
Moore Industries is a 40-year industrial contractor delivering civil, industrial buildings, industrial HVAC, and facility maintenance services. In recent years, the company has been growing rapidly, strengthening its leadership, expanding geographically, and increasing self-perform capabilities across multiple disciplines. This growth is creating meaningful opportunities for talented professionals who want to grow, improve, and lead with purpose.
Position Summary:
The Staff Accountant is a key member of the finance team respon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, supporting job cost accounting, and assisting supporting operations depending on business needs. The position would primarily report to the Controller while working with the HR Manager, accounts payable and payroll staff, and the CFO.
An accounting degree is preferred. Experience working within an ERP is required, with Viewpoint Spectrum or Deltek Computer Ease a plus.
Job duties will include, but are not limited to, the following:
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ist and backup accounts payable staff. Process invoices from material vendors and subcontractors.
- Research invoice problems encountered during the entry process.
- Prepare approved invoices for payment and verify coding and accuracy of invoices submitted. Process company payments in a timely manner and in accordance with established policies and procedures.
- Resolve inquiries about open accounts payable items. Reconcile monthly vendor statements.
- Assist and backup payroll staff in processing payroll and employee reimbursements.
- Enter client invoices into the accounting system. Post accounts receivable payments received from clients.
- Assist with bank reconciliations, monthly accruals, preparation of job schedule and closing of financial statements.
- Provide feedback to management and recommend enhancements to gain efficiencies and better represent Moore Industries to our vendors and employees.
- Manage multi-state business licenses
- Assist and backup HR staff with onboarding new hires, processing new hire paperwork, scheduling drug and other testing, background checks, etc. as needed.
- Assist with administration of employee benefit plans – primarily health insurance and 401K.
